PERIOD BRASS COPY OF COLT .36 BULLET MOLD
EARLY 1st MODEL SQUAREBACK 1851 NAVY 
FREE SHIPPING!!


This .36 caliber bullet mold is a period commercial/ aftermarket copy of the ULTRA- RARE Colt M21 (Rapley ref. number) brass bullet mold for the early 1st model 1851 Squareback Navy revolvers. It's a very close copy. The only differences I see are that the locating pin is on the left side vs. right on the Colt molds and this one is longer (5-3/8") vs. 4-7/8" on the Colt. Of course this mold would also be correct to display with a 2nd model 1851 Navy too, the only difference being the 2nd model bullet has a grease groove and the 1st doesn't.
I've never even seen a 1st model Colt mold for sale. If you're lucky enough to find one you'll probably have to pay $600-1,000 or more for one!
The mold is completely original and un-messed with. No markings whatsoever. Nice patina overall.
